> 文章列表 > linux创建数据库用户

linux创建数据库用户

linux创建数据库用户

什么是Linux创建数据库用户

在开发与管理服务器时,创建数据库用户是很常见的任务。在Linux系统中,创建数据库用户通常使用命令行界面,这需要一定的技能和知识。在本文中,我们将介绍Linux创建数据库用户的方法。

使用命令行创建数据库用户

在Linux中使用命令行创建数据库用户,需要在终端中使用特定的命令。例如,在MySQL中,我们可以通过以下步骤来创建数据库用户:

  1. 使用root用户登录到MySQL服务器
  2. 创建新的数据库用户
  3. 设置新用户的密码
  4. 分配用户的权限
  5. 退出MySQL命令行

创建新用户

使用以下命令在MySQL数据库中创建新用户:

CREATE USER 'new_username'@'localhost' IDENTIFIED BY 'user_password';

其中new_username是要创建的新用户的名称,localhost表示只允许本地访问,如果需要远程访问则需要改为IP地址或域名。 user_password是新用户的密码,可以使用任何强密码。

设置新用户的密码

使用以下命令为新用户设置密码:

SET PASSWORD FOR 'new_username'@'localhost' = PASSWORD('new_password');

其中new_username是刚刚创建的新用户的用户名。 new_password是新密码,请将其替换为新用户的实际密码。

分配用户的权限

在MySQL中,可以使用以下命令为新用户分配数据库权限:

GRANT ALL PRIVILEGES ON * . * TO 'new_username'@'localhost';

该命令将为新用户授予所有数据库的所有权限。

结束语

创建数据库用户是在Linux服务器管理中的一个基本任务。在本文中,我们介绍了使用命令行在MySQL数据库中创建新用户的方法。通过了解这些基本知识,您可以管理Linux服务器并为数据库用户提供必要的权限。